Second seed Koneru Humpy (6 points) jumped into lead with an emphatic victory over Ju Wenjun in the seventh round of the FIDE Women’s GP in Ankara here on Sunday. The Indian’s fifth victory gave her half a point lead over her nearest rival Anna Muzychuk. After gaining advantage in the opening from the white side of Kings Indian Defence (g3 system), Humpy won an exchange on the 19th move. Humpy converted the material advantage to victory after 72 moves.
Results (7th round): Koneru Humpy (Ind, 6) bt Ju Wenjun (Chn, 4); Zhao Xue (Chn, 4.5) drew A Muzychuk (Slo, 5.5); M Socko (Pol, 1.5) lost to T Kosintseva (Rus, 3.5); B Yildiz (Tur, 2) drew K Ozturk (Tur, 1.5); V Cmilyte (Ltu, 4) drew Ruan Lufei (Chn, 4.5), A Stefanova (Bul, 1.5) drew B Munguntuul (Mon, 3.5).
